How Close Can You Get to Gorillas? 2026 Guidelines

How Close Can You Get to Gorillas? Official Gorilla Trekking Distance 2026

In 2026, the direct answer to “How Close Can You Get to Gorillas?” is  you must maintain a distance of 10 meters (approximately 32 feet)  from gorillas. This rule is strictly enforced in Uganda’s Bwindi and Mgahinga, as well as Rwanda’s Volcanoes National Park.

  • Standard Distance: 10 Meters.
  • Reason for Distance: To prevent the transmission of human respiratory diseases and to avoid stressing the animals.
  • Mask Requirement: Travelers must wear a medical face mask when in the presence of the gorillas.
  • If a Gorilla Approaches: Stay calm, crouch down, and follow your ranger’s instructions—do not move away rapidly or touch them.

The 10-Meter Rule: Why Distance is Critical in 2026

One of the most common questions we receive at Active Uganda Safaris is: “How close can you get to gorillas?” While the experience feels incredibly intimate, there are strict conservation protocols in place to protect the mountain gorillas, who share over 98% of our DNA.

As of 2026, the minimum viewing distance has been updated to 10 meters. This change from the previous 7-meter rule ensures an extra layer of safety against zoonotic diseases (illnesses that jump from humans to animals).

Why Can’t I Get Closer to the Gorillas?

Maintaining a 10-meter gap is not just about human safety; it is primarily about the survival of the species.

1. Health and Disease Prevention

Because gorillas are so closely related to us, they are highly susceptible to human illnesses like the common cold, flu, and other respiratory infections. What might be a minor cough for a human could be fatal for a gorilla.

2. Behavioral Respect

Mountain gorillas are wild animals. Even though the families you visit are habituated (accustomed to humans), they still require personal space. Maintaining distance prevents the silverback from feeling the need to defend his family, ensuring the group remains relaxed and continues their natural behaviors like grooming and feeding.

What Happens if a Gorilla Approaches Me?

Mountain gorillas do not understand the 10-meter rule! Occasionally, a curious juvenile or even a silverback may walk directly toward you. If this happens:

  • Stay Still and Calm: Do not run away, as this can trigger a chase instinct.
  • Crouch Down: Lowering your height shows the silverback that you are submissive and not a threat.
  • Avoid Direct Eye Contact: Staring can be interpreted as a challenge or a sign of aggression.
  • Follow the Ranger: Your guide will quietly signal you to move back slowly to re-establish the required distance.

2026 Photography Tips from a Distance

You don’t need to be right next to a gorilla to get a world-class photo.

  • Lens Choice: We recommend a lens with a focal length of at least 70mm to 200mm.
  • Disable Flash: Flash is strictly prohibited as it startles the gorillas and can provoke a charge.
  • Stay Low: Often, the best shots are taken from a crouching position, capturing the gorillas at eye level.

 

Gorilla Trekking Distance & Protocol Summary

Protocol Item 2026 Official Requirement
Minimum Distance 10 Meters (32 Feet)
Face Masks Mandatory during the 1-hour encounter
Time Limit Maximum 1 Hour with the gorilla family
Group Size 8 Tourists per gorilla group per day
Health Check No trekking if you have any signs of illness
